Is Diet Soda A Better Option?

The United States addiction to soda is alarming. Did you know that Americans are estimated to consume more than 13.5 billion gallons of soda annually? This statistic becomes more alarming considering that there are approximately nine teaspoons of sugar in every 12-ounce can of soda. Therefore, in order to cut calories, many individuals have decided to switch to diet soda. But, have you ever wondered if switching to diet soda makes you live a healthier lifestyle or if it prevents you from reaching your weight loss and fitness goals?

Enhancing People’s Knowledge On The Different Forms Of Eating Disorders

In the recent decades attention has been turned to eating disorders, how common they are, and how they can be stopped. Eating disorders are classified into three different types: anorexia, bulimia, and binge eating. All three are equally dangerous and have severe consequences. Doctors can usually tell who is at risk for an eating disorder.
